Mid-Pacific Institute faced Damien in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Tuesday. The Owls fell just short of the Monarchs by a score of 4-3.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Monarchs this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 3-2 two weeks ago.
Mid-Pacific Institute has also traveled a rocky road recently, having lost five of their last six matchups. That's put a noticeable dent in their 2-5-1 record this season. As for Damien, they have been performing well recently as they've won six of their last eight cont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 7-4 record this season.
